Michigan Democratic Senate candidate Abdul El-Sayed refused to consider returning campaign donations from groups linked to Islamic terrorism — and claimed that it was racist to suggest that he should. During an interview that aired on FOX 2 Detroit on Tuesday, El-Sayed addressed recent comments from his opponent in the U.S. Senate race, Rep. Mike Rogers (R-MI).
